Replace or Reinstall Mouse Drivers
Outdated or corrupted mouse drivers may cause cursor disappearance points. To resolve this, observe these steps:
- Proper-click on the Begin menu and choose “Machine Supervisor”.
- Broaden the “Mice and different pointing units” part.
- Proper-click in your mouse driver and choose “Replace Driver”.
- If Home windows would not discover an up to date driver, manually obtain the newest driver from the laptop computer producer’s web site.
- If updating the motive force would not work, right-click on the mouse driver and choose “Uninstall Machine”. Restart your laptop computer and Home windows will robotically reinstall the motive force.

Updating Machine Drivers
Machine drivers are software program applications that enable your working system to speak together with your {hardware} units. In case your cursor just isn’t working correctly, it might be as a result of the motive force in your touchpad or mouse is outdated or corrupted. To replace your gadget drivers, observe these steps:
- Open the Machine Supervisor. You are able to do this by urgent Home windows Key + R and typing "devmgmt.msc" into the Run dialog field.
- Broaden the "Mice and different pointing units" class.
- Proper-click in your touchpad or mouse and choose "Replace driver."
- Click on on "Search robotically for up to date driver software program."
- If Home windows finds a brand new driver, it’ll obtain and set up it robotically. If Home windows doesn’t discover a new driver, you possibly can attempt downloading the motive force from the producer’s web site.

Performing a System Restore
A system restore reverts your laptop computer to a earlier cut-off date when the cursor was working correctly. This course of doesn’t have an effect on your private recordsdata, however it’ll take away any applications or updates that had been put in after the restore level was created.
To carry out a system restore, observe these steps:
1. Open the Begin menu and kind “System Restore”.
2. Click on on the “System Restore” icon.
3. Click on on the “Subsequent” button.
4. Choose the restore level that you simply need to use and click on on the “Subsequent” button.
5. Click on on the “Subsequent” button to begin the restore course of.
6. The restore course of might take a number of minutes. As soon as it’s full, it is possible for you to to log in to your laptop computer and examine if the cursor is working correctly.

Resetting BIOS Defaults
If you happen to’ve tried all of the earlier steps and nonetheless cannot get your cursor again, resetting BIOS defaults could also be your final resort. This can return your BIOS settings to their manufacturing facility defaults, which can resolve cursor points brought on by incorrect settings.
Step 1: Entry BIOS
Restart your laptop computer and press the designated key (often F1, F2, Del, or Esc) to enter the BIOS. The precise key might range relying in your Lenovo mannequin.
Step 2: Navigate to BIOS Settings
As soon as in BIOS, use the arrow keys to navigate to the “Exit” tab. If you happen to do not see an “Exit” tab, attempt the “Restart” tab or the “Save & Exit” possibility.
Step 3: Discover BIOS Reset Possibility
Throughout the “Exit” tab, search for an possibility referred to as “Reset to Default” or “Load Default Settings.” The precise wording might range.
Step 4: Affirm Reset
Press the “Enter” key to verify the reset. This can restore your BIOS settings to manufacturing facility defaults and restart your laptop computer.
Step 5: Verify Cursor
After the laptop computer restarts, examine in case your cursor has returned. If not, chances are you’ll must repeat the method or contact Lenovo help for additional help.
